{Ed002's Note - As has been repeatedly explained, Lacazette's position is complex as it involves another player, Fekir. There is interest in him from a number of clubs including Manchester City, Bayern Munich, Juventus, Arsenal and, in particular PSG and there have been a number of discussions about his future. Manchester City moved on to buy Bony in January and now need to be making space if they are going to continue their interest in Lacazette. With Jovetic and probably Dzeko leaving in the summer nothing will come of it unless Aguero were to also leave. Guy Hillion has been looking at Lacazette but there has been no offer made by Chelsea - but they have seemingly lost out on their identified targets and they are looking for forwards. Much will depend on the future of the other player and what happens in terms of success this season and Champions League qualification. My expectation is that he will stay at Lyon.}
